Зачем в order.Condition private set?

Зачем в order.Condition private set?
Atom
2/19/2010
gravi


Делаю order = new Order() if.... order.price = .... if .... order.... и т.д. мне тут так проще, чем методы плодить.

order.Condition = new ......, потом через If выбираю набор условий, а тут облом) Вопрос зачем private set?

PS. Чайник я)


Tags:


Thanks:


Mikhail Sukhov

Avatar
Date: 2/19/2010
Reply


Все просто. Condition - это сложно составное свойство. Нет никакого смысла его менять самого, а есть смысл менять его внутренние свойства (стоп цена, условия срабатывания и т.д.).

Thanks:

gravi

Avatar
Date: 2/20/2010
Reply


То есть, только через конструктор order?

Thanks:

gravi

Avatar
Date: 2/20/2010
Reply


ааа, ступил...))) то-есть, дошло!

Thanks:


Attach files by dragging & dropping, , or pasting from the clipboard.

loading
clippy